  • Lemont, Pennsylvania Census Data
  • The total number of people in Lemont is 795. Of those, 392 are Male (49.31 %) and 403 are Female (50.69 %).

    In Lemont, Pennsylvania 37.3 is the median age.

    Lemont, Pennsylvania population is broken down (as a percentage) by age as follows:

    Under Age of 5: 5.03 %
    Ages 5 to 9: 8.55 %
    Ages 10 to 14: 7.42 %
    Ages 15 to 19: 7.42 %
    Ages 20 to 24: 4.91 %
    Ages 25 to 34: 12.20 %
    Ages 35 to 44: 21.26 %
    Ages 45 to 54: 17.61 %
    Ages 55 to 59: 4.65 %
    Ages 60 to 64: 3.14 %
    Ages 65 to 74: 3.90 %
    Ages 75 to 84: 3.52 %
    Over the age of 85: 0.38 %

    Analysis of Education/Enrollment in Lemont, Pennsylvania:
    A total of 284 people over the age of three are enrolled in school in Lemont.
    Of the total enrolled in Lemont:
    25 children in Lemont are enrolled in Nursery School.
    24 children are attending Kindergarten in Lemont.
    111 children in Lemont attend Primary School
    65 young people in Lemont attend Secondary School.
    59 people are enrolled in college in Lemont.
    95 people have a High School diploma (or equivalent).
    78 people have attended some college (without a degree).
    18 people in Lemont have an Associates Degree.
    197 people in Lemont have a Bachelors Degree.
    145 people in Lemont have a Graduate Degree.

    Lemont Statistical Data
    Lemont, Pennsylvania Total Area covers 0.3 Square Miles.
    Total Water Area is 0.00 Square Miles.
    Total Land Area is 0.3 Square Miles.
    In Lemont, PA. pop. density is 2,638.67 persons/square mile.
    Lemont, Pennsylvania is located in the Eastern (GMT -5) Time Zone.
    The elevation in Lemont is 745 Ft.

Typically one of the number one concerns of a person in Lemont with a substance abuse issue seeking treatment at a drug treatment and alcohol rehab facility for the treatment of their addiction is location. The initial thing that comes to mind for most people is a drug rehab and alcohol treatment program close to home, usually either in Lemont, PA. or a couple hours drive from there. While this may bring about convenience, it does not mean that it is the most effective treatment option for you or a loved one with an addiction to alcohol or drugs. drug treatment and alcohol rehabilitation facilities close to Lemont can make it much too easy to remain in communication with drug using acquaintances and other familiar situations that can trigger a drug or alcohol relapse. Also, it makes it quite easy to suddenly leave the drug treatment and alcohol rehabilitation facility when the going gets rough in the early phase of the recovery process, it can and commonly does get a bit rough, this is normal until the particular person gets used to a daily regimen without the use of a drug or alcohol. If you are in Lemont near the associates and places that you used drugs or alcohol with, when thinks seem difficult you know exactly who you can call that will come and get you and bring you out for a drink or a fix. When you or your loved one attends a drug rehab and alcohol treatment facility that is a significant distance away from home, the familiar triggers for a drug or alcohol relapse are not present. Minimizing relapse triggers is a crucial part to the recovery of drug or alcohol addiction.

Attending a drug and alcohol treatment center will offer a safe and secure environment normally involving 24 hour supervision and expert treatment so you can commence the healing process of recovery from drug addiction or alcoholism. Tapering off drug or alcohol use can help somewhat to minimize withdrawal symptoms, but for many individuals, specifically those that abuse highly addictive drugs for a prolonged period of time, it simply may not be feasible to do that. The drug addiction or alcoholism can simply have progressed too far and the impulse to use a drug or alcohol has grown to be too powerful. In such cases, an alcohol or drug detoxification facility is the safest route to handling the withdrawal process. Most drug rehab and alcohol rehabilitation programs provide a medical detox regimen to treat withdrawal symptoms that are brought on by the sudden discontinuation of addictive drugs or alcohol so that the sometimes uncomfortable withdrawal process can be made more pleasant for the patient. Stopping the use of addictive drugs and alcohol employing the cold turkey technique is not encouraged due to the fact it can sometimes bring about life-threatening withdrawal symptoms, such as seizures and convulsions.

Some of the indicators of drug addiction or alcoholism include poor school or employment attendance and performance, unhealthy hygiene and appearance, changes in eating habits, unusual sleeping habits, shying away from close friends, neglecting responsibilities, money troubles, anger and hostility toward family, withdrawal symptoms when the drug or alcohol is not obtainable, severe urges and the need to get hold of the drug or alcohol despite the consequences including but not limited to lying and stealing to get it. If any of these addiction signs are present in yourself or a loved one, it is quite probable that you have an addiction issue and would benefit significantly from the professional services of a drug treatment and alcohol rehab program to recover from it.
